Teaching at multiple colleges

If you teach at more than one college, you don't need separate apps or logins. One Daily Tab account covers every college you teach at — you just pick which one you're working in.

One login for everywhere you teach

You sign in once, with a single email and password, and every college you belong to lives in that one account. Your name and password belong to the account, not to any one college, so you set them once and they apply everywhere. Each college still keeps its own classes, students, and calendar separately.

Joining a second college is automatic. If you already use Daily Tab, another college can add you with the same email — no new invite to accept, no new password. The college simply appears in your list the next time you open the app. You only go through the invite (password and terms) the very first time you join Daily Tab.

Choosing a college when you sign in

If you belong to more than one college and haven't chosen one yet, you'll see a Select College screen — "You have access to more than one college. Choose one to continue." — with a dropdown to pick. Daily Tab remembers your choice, so next time you go straight in without picking again.

If you belong to just one college, this screen is skipped — the app opens straight to it.

Switching between colleges

You can switch college anytime, without signing out. The college dropdown appears in the header of two tabs: on Attendance, next to "Hello, {your name}," and on Dashboard, next to the class and subject filters.

When you switch, everything reloads for the new college — its classes, its subjects, its attendance. You'll pick a class and subject for that college, or go straight in if you only have one there. Nothing is ever mixed between colleges.

The switcher only appears if you belong to more than one college. With a single college, there's no dropdown — there's nothing to switch between.

If you're an administrator somewhere too

Your role is set per college — you might be a teacher at one and an administrator at another. When you switch to a college where you're an administrator, Daily Tab opens that college's admin tools instead of the teacher view. Switch to a college where you're only a teacher, and you're back in the teacher app.

If you're an administrator at a college but also teach there, you'll see a Teaching view bar with a Switch to admin option, so you can move between marking your own classes and managing the college.

If a college is no longer available

If a college you belonged to is closed, or you're removed from it, it simply drops off your list. If none of your colleges are active anymore, you'll see a "This college is no longer active" screen. If you think that's a mistake, contact your administrator or email support@dailytab.app.
